Home Check-in: Your Service Journey Begins Before You Arrive
One of the most significant advantages of Kia's new service offerings is the ability to initiate your vehicle's service check-in from the comfort of your own home. This home check-in feature is a game-changer for busy individuals who value their time. Imagine being able to start the entire process without even leaving your house. Here's how it benefits you:
- Start from your mobile phone: In today's mobile-first world, the ability to manage tasks via your smartphone is essential. Kia's home check-in allows you to access the service portal through your mobile device, initiating the process anytime, anywhere. This means you can complete the initial steps during your commute, over a lunch break, or even while relaxing at home.
- Confirm or provide additional work requirements in advance: This feature offers unparalleled flexibility and ensures your service experience is tailored to your specific needs. Before you even hand over your keys, you can clearly communicate any specific concerns you have about your vehicle, or detail any additional work you require. This proactive communication minimises misunderstandings and allows the service centre to prepare accordingly, potentially speeding up the servicing process itself. You can confirm existing service requirements, add notes about unusual noises, or request specific checks.
- Fully digital online check-in: Embracing a paperless approach, the entire check-in process is conducted online. This not only contributes to environmental sustainability but also ensures that all your information is securely stored and easily accessible. Digital records are less prone to loss or damage compared to paper documents, offering a more reliable and organised system.

Self-Service Kiosk Check-in: Flexibility and Security at Your Fingertips
For those who prefer a more direct, on-site experience, Kia's Self-Service Kiosk Check-in provides a convenient and secure alternative. These kiosks are strategically placed to offer flexibility, especially for those who might not be able to make it during standard business hours or prefer a quick, contactless drop-off.
- Digital check-in and key drop flexibility: The kiosks offer a fully digital check-in experience, mirroring the convenience of the home check-in. Crucially, they also provide a secure and flexible way to drop off your vehicle's keys. This is particularly useful if you need to drop off your car early in the morning or late in the afternoon, outside of the main service reception hours.
- Secure customer signature process and safe key drop off: Security is a top priority. The kiosks feature a secure digital signature process, ensuring that your authorisation for the service work is legally captured and protected. The key drop mechanism is designed for safety and integrity, providing peace of mind that your keys are stored securely until they are needed by the service team.
- Kiosk check-in available 6-days per week: To maximise convenience, the self-service kiosks are available six days a week, aligning with typical showroom opening hours. This extended availability means you have more opportunities to drop off your vehicle at a time that suits your schedule, minimising disruption to your daily routine.

Self-Service Kiosk Check-out: A Seamless Collection Experience
The innovation doesn't stop at check-in; Kia has also applied its digital prowess to the vehicle collection process with the Self-Service Kiosk Check-out. This service is designed to make picking up your serviced vehicle as effortless as possible.
- Safe code PIN sent prior to collection: To ensure a secure and private handover, you will receive a unique safe code or PIN prior to collecting your vehicle. This code acts as your digital key to the collection process, confirming your identity and authorising the release of your vehicle. This adds an extra layer of security, preventing unauthorised access.
- Secure digital customer signature process: Similar to the check-in, the collection process also incorporates a secure digital signature. This allows you to digitally approve the completed work and acknowledge the collection of your vehicle, maintaining the integrity and security of the transaction.
- Aftersales collections 6-Days per week: The self-service kiosks facilitate aftersales collections six days a week, mirroring the opening hours of the showroom. This means you can collect your vehicle at your convenience, often outside of traditional peak times, making the process smoother and less hurried.
